After boiling the fruit with sugar for the specified time in the recipe (usually around 10 – 30 minutes) a measured amount of liquid pectin is added at the end, boiled for a few minutes further, before the jam is added to sterilised jars. Commercial pectin is manufactured from citrus or apple peels and sold as a liquid or powder. Both forms give good results but the methods of adding ingredients differ. Blueberries: only use fresh, ripe blueberries for this recipe. They will have the best acidity and tannins to give the jam a more complex flavor, and the skins will be the proper texture. Frozen blueberries tend to be mushier and more watery than fresh fruit when thawed, which will likely alter the consistency of your jam. Companies commonly use pectin in food as a gelling agent, particularly in jams and jellies. It is also used in fillings, medicines, laxatives, throat lozenges, sweets, fruit juices, milk drinks and as a source of dietary fiber.
